Detailsinfo

A vulnerability was found in Open Mainframe Project Zowe up to 2.13.x. It has been classified as critical. This affects some unknown functionality of the component APIML Spring Cloud Gateway. The manipulation with an unknown input leads to a certificate validation vulnerability. CWE is classifying the issue as CWE-295. The product does not validate, or incorrectly validates, a certificate.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:

A vulnerability in APIML Spring Cloud Gateway which leverages user privileges by unexpected signing proxied request by Zowe's client certificate. This allows access to a user to the endpoints requiring an internal client certificate without any credentials. It could lead to managing components in there and allow an attacker to handle the whole communication including user credentials.

The weakness was presented by Pavel Jares. The advisory is shared at github.com. This vulnerability is uniquely identified as CVE-2024-6834 since 07/17/2024. The exploitability is told to be difficult. It is possible to initiate the attack remotely. No form of authentication is needed for exploitation. Neither technical details nor an exploit are publicly available. MITRE ATT&CK project uses the attack technique T1587.003 for this issue.

Upgrading to version 2.14.0 eliminates this vulnerability.
